A Franchise That Would Add to Southern Utah's Food Scene

A doughnut shop that started in 2019 in Indiana has made its way to Utah with a location in Provo. I’m always thinking of new franchises I would like to see open up in Southern Utah, and Parlor Doughnuts is now on that list. 

It isn’t like we don’t have some great donut places in the southern part of the state. I have been happy with the increasing options. It is more that the pastries being made in Provo are in a different category. 

Savory Layered Doughnuts: A New Experience

First off, they don’t spell it the same. It is a doughnut and they make it with layered dough. I’m not sure what that means, but the texture and taste is different from any of the donuts I have tasted before.

They have some amazing, sweet varieties like Cookies n’ Cream, Chocolate Chocolate, and Maple Bacon. I don’t eat a lot of sugar, so I only looked at these. I was all about the savory layered doughnuts.

These were a circle of the layered dough with pizza like toppings on top. I tried the Margherita, Hawaiian BBQ Chicken, and the one I liked the best, the Chicken Bacon Ranch. They were all good but the last was exceptional. 

If you get a chance when you are driving through Provo, stop and try one of these unique pastries. And if you are looking for a franchise to bring to the southern part of the state, this would make a great addition.
